本文主要介绍了汪清iOS软件高级教程的全解析,分为五个大段落,内容涵盖了iOS开发基础、UI界面、数据存储、网络通信和高级技巧等方面。本文旨在帮助读者全面掌握iOS开发的相关知识,从入门到精通。
1. iOS开发基础
iOS开发是一门涉及多种技术领域的复杂学科,学习基础知识是非常必要的。本节将介绍iOS开发的基础知识,包括Xcode、Swift语言、常用控件和MVC架构等方面。
2. UI界面
iOS应用的用户体验以及界面美观程度是用户选择使用应用的重要因素之一。本节将重点介绍iOS应用中的UI界面开发,包括常用控件、布局方式以及动画效果等方面。
3. 数据存储
数据存储是iOS应用开发中非常重要的一个方面,涉及到本地数据存储、网络数据通信以及数据加密等相关知识。本节将介绍iOS应用中的常用数据存储方式和技术,包括Core Data、SQLite、JSON解析和加密算法等方面。
4. 网络通信
网络通信是现代移动应用开发中必不可少的一个组成部分。本节将介绍iOS应用中的网络通信技术,包括HTTP协议、NSURLSession、AFNetworking等常用网络通信框架的使用和实践。
5. 高级技巧
iOS应用开发的高级技巧涉及到多种领域,包括性能优化、调试技巧、UI自定义等方面。本节将介绍一些常用的高级技巧,帮助读者进一步提升自己的开发水平。
通过本文的介绍,我们了解了iOS开发的基础知识、UI界面、数据存储、网络通信和高级技巧等方面的内容。希望本文能够帮助读者更好地掌握iOS开发技术,进一步提升自己的开发水平。未来,我们也期待更多有趣、实用的iOS应用能够诞生,为用户带来更好的使用体验。
本篇文章是以“”为主题,介绍了汪清老师的iOS软件高级教程。全文分为五个大段落,包括笔者对汪清老师的评价、汪清老师讲授的内容、汪清老师的教学方法、汪清老师的教学效果以及结语。通过本文,您将对汪清老师的教学有更深入的了解,并可以更好地学习和掌握iOS软件开发的技术。
1.评价汪清老师的教学
作为iOS软件开发领域的知名人士,汪清老师多次为大家带来了优质、高水平的教学内容。笔者认为,汪清老师的教学方法独具特色,深入浅出,非常易于理解和掌握。他的教学风格也非常严谨,注重理论和实践的结合,让学生能够真正地理解和运用所学知识。此外,汪清老师的课程内容非常丰富,从基础知识到高级技术都会涉及到,所以适合不同层次的学生。
2.汪清老师讲授的内容
汪清老师的iOS教程覆盖了移动设备软件开发的各个方面,其中包括Objective-C语言、Swift语言、基础UI控件、常用网络请求、图形绘制、数据库操作、多线程与GCD、高级动画效果、音视频处理、数据加密与解密技术等。这些知识点的讲解都非常详细,汪清老师会通过实际案例进行演示,让学生深入理解每一个知识点。
3.汪清老师的教学方法
汪清老师的教学方法非常实用,他经常会通过实际的案例来帮助学生理解和运用所学知识。在教学过程中,他也会有针对性地解决学生的问题和困惑,不仅注重理论知识的讲解,更注重实践能力的培养。此外,汪清老师的教学中也注重与学生的互动,在教学过程中鼓励学生积极思考和提问。
4.汪清老师的教学效果
笔者认为,汪清老师的教学效果非常显著。多年的教学经验让他对学生的学习状态和需求有着深刻的理解和洞察力,并且他的教学内容很实用,可直接应用于实际开发中。因此,学生在学习过程中会对所学知识感到兴趣,提高学习积极性,并取得较好的学习效果。许多学生参与到他的教学中,受益颇多。
5.结语
总的来说,汪清老师的iOS软件高级教程广受好评,他独特的教学方法以及深刻的教学理念使得学生很容易获得优质的学习资源和良好的学习环境。如果你想从入门到精通iOS开发,汪清老师的课程值得一试。